Tracheostomy Tube, Flexible, Shiley™, PVC, Adult Age Group, High-Volume, Low-Pressure, Low-Profile Cuff, 8mm Inner Diameter, 11.4mm Outer Diameter, 77mm Length, 7mm Inner Cannula ID, Latex-Free, Sterile, Single-Use, With Disposable Inner Cannula
Shiley™ tracheostomy tubes have a proven 40-year history with over 760 million products used around the world. These clinician-inspired enhancements include the taper-shaped TaperGuard™ cuff. The TaperGuard™ cuff may help protect the lungs and reduce tracheal impact by reducing fluid leakage by 99% and exerting 18.6% less lateral wall pressure on the trachea. In addition, TaperGuard™ cuff technology helps improve a clinician’s ability to provide mechanical ventilation with the ability to titrate ventilator air leak that is 65% greater than with earlier-generation Shiley™ tubes. Shiley™ flexible tubes were designed with larger inner diameters, compared to earlier Shiley™ tracheostomy tubes. Airflow around the outer cannula when the cuff is deflated has increased by an average of 242%. It has been found that improved airflow may reduce the work of breathing required to speak and wean from a tracheostomy tube. Other enhancements in the new family of Shiley™ flexible tracheostomy tubes include color-coding by size (for disposable inner cannula products only), an expanded range of sizes, a soft material made with a non-DEHP plasticizer, a clear flange and a design that make it possible to ventilate with or without an inner cannula.
